Global service provider Hawksford has announced the promotion of a new Managing Director in its Jersey office.
Formerly Head of Family Office for Jersey, Laura Nevitt has been promoted to the role of Managing Director in the firm’s Private Client and Family Office.
In her new wider role, Ms Nevitt will be responsible for a 50-strong team of private client professionals.
She will work collaboratively with teams across Hawksford’s other global locations to grow and enhance the firm’s proposition for private client and family office services.
Ms Nevitt joined Hawksford in 2017 and has specific expertise in family office solutions, luxury assets and international asset protection and succession planning.
She has previously won ‘Trustee of the year – Director’ category in Citywealth’s Future Leaders Awards, and featured regularly in the eprivateclient ‘Top 35 under 35’ lists.
